Still the Enemy Within is a unique insight into one of history's most dramatic events: the 1984-85 British Miners' Strike. No experts. No politicians. Thirty years on, this is the raw first-hand experience of those who lived through Britain's longest strike. Follow the highs and lows of that life-changing year. Read more …
Documentary on the miners' strike from Owen Gower illuminates a passionately fought conflict.
This is unashamedly partisan, yet the film’s strength lies in giving voice to the conflict’s ‘losers.’
It is, as a consequence, unashamedly one-sided, although some of the footage is provocative (witness protesters going up against militarised policemen on horseback) and the interviewees’ testimonies are insightful.
A testament to the dignity that comes from standing up to giant oppressors.
Owen Gower’s film about striking miners is a heartfelt tribute to communities hammered by political forces.
